Beijing is a city of 14 million people. Being in the dry northern part of China, Beijing shares many of the same challenges of Southern NEvada such as a major water shortage (tap water is not potable), traffic congestion (40,000 people were killed in auto accidents the first 4 months of the year in Beijing), air pollution ( a bad day in LA is a good day in Beijing), and illegal immigration (estimated to have 2-3 million in the city today). The problems might be similar but the scale of the problems here is overwhelming!

Today we visited the section of the Great Wall that was built during the Ming Dynasty, about 1400 AD. It was built to secure a mountain pass that was the main route into Mongolia. I climbed more stairs today that I ever want to see again. We also visited the Ming Tombs that were all built in the same area because of excellent Feng Shui.

Great Wall
Boy, am I confused! I have been looking at different websites of the Great Wall and have found way different information. While most sites agree that it was built by 3 main dynasties (Qin, Han & Ming) starting in about 221 BC to keep out invaders from the north (the Mongols), they can't quite agree on how long it is. I have seen anywhere from 1,500 miles to 4,500 miles, and one site stating that it could be as long as 50,000 km (31,068 miles!).
